What is a Bullet Journal?

Bullet Journal is a customizable planning system you create in a notebook. Your Bullet Journal is a place to preserve your past, track your current activities, and plan the future.

The beauty of the system is that you are the only one who decides what elements to add there, how to make your pages look, and how to organize them. How amazing is it?

This means that there isn’t a right or wrong way to Bullet Journal. There are however a few basic concepts your Bullet Journal involves around.

What is a Digital Bullet Journal?

Similar to a traditional bullet journal, a digital bullet journal is an interactive notebook used on the iPad, instead of a pen and paper.

The digital bullet journal has links called hyperlinks. When you click on a link to the journal index or title, it takes you to a specific page in the journal.

For example, look at the image below. When you click on one of the tabs or bullet points, you are automatically taken to a specific journal page where you can customize it.

Digital Bullet Journal Termonigy

The digital bullet journal has the basic concept of a traditional bullet journal and adds more functions from a digital planner to make it easy to use and allow for unlimited creation. So you are familiar with the basic concept of terms

1. Bullet Journal Spreads / Collections

Think of your digital Bullet Journal as a building, and the spreads or collections you use in it are the building blocks. The beauty of the system is, of course, that there’s an unlimited amount of different pages you can use, and you can come up with your own unique pages suited to your personal needs.

2. Rapid Logging

Rapid logging is the language your journal is written in. It’s pretty simple – all your journal entries are made in short sentences and marked by a special symbol.

The basic symbols in the bullet journal are:

  1. Dot – task

  2. Circle – event

  3. Dash – note

  4. Exclamation Mark – important

You are, of course, welcome to create your own, but always keep in mind that less is more, you need your signifiers to be easy to go to.

3. Migration

Migration is a way to review. You migrate your tasks from day to day, from month to month, and then you, of course, migrate your journal to a new notebook. This process allows you to re-evaluate what things are important in your life.


Reflection pages

Reflection pages

4. Reflections

The Bullet Journal method first and foremost is about building a better and more meaningful life. Reflections are what help you the most to achieve that.

Every time you sit down to plan, reflect on what happened the day before and think of what you could do better today. This is the way to move forward.
